What is the Medication Authorization Form?
The Medication Authorization Form is a vital document required by Itasca School District #10, designed to authorize school personnel to safely administer medications to students. This form falls under the category of educational forms, providing necessary legal backing for medication administration during school hours.
This form facilitates communication between parents, physicians, and school staff by ensuring that all medication is given in accordance with physician guidelines. It is essential for both the physician and parent to provide their signatures to validate the administration process and uphold the school's legal responsibilities.

Who needs to sign the Medication Authorization Form?
Both a physician and a parent or legal guardian are required to sign the Medication Authorization Form to ensure proper authorization for medication administration at school.
What happens if I don’t submit this form?
If the Medication Authorization Form is not submitted, school personnel will not be authorized to administer any medication to the student, which could lead to health risks for those requiring medication during school hours.
Are there specific deadlines for submitting this form?
While specific deadlines may vary by school district, it is generally advised to submit the Medication Authorization Form well before the school year starts or before the first day the medication is needed.
Can I submit the form electronically?
Yes, the Medication Authorization Form can often be submitted electronically through your school’s portal or emailed directly to the designated school health contact, but confirm with your school’s guidelines.
What supporting documents are required with this form?
Typically, you may need to include a copy of the physician's prescription or any other relevant medical documentation that supports the need for medication administration in school.
